A+++ tumble dryer heat pump
+ Tumble Dryer Heat Pump Technology
A tumble dryer with heat pump technology is a great investment in energy efficiency. It may cost more than traditional models, but you'll save money on energy costs.
It is also gentler and quieter on your clothes. This makes it a perfect option for families with children.
Capacity
The tumble dryers of the heat pump absorb the water by using hot air from outside. They then recycle and reuse it. They are more energy-efficient and can help you save money on your electric bill while being kinder to the environment. They also generally have higher capacity than condenser and vented tumble dryers, which means they can handle larger loads in one step.
The majority of our tumble dryers with heat pumps have an A+++ rating for energy efficiency. These tumble dryers made by heat pumps are a great alternative for condenser models, as they do not use heat elements. They can be put in any place within your home. Typically, they can dry 8kg of laundry in around two hours, which is around half the time it takes a condenser dryer to accomplish the same.
The tumble dryers that use heat pumps are gentle on your clothes as they operate at lower temperatures. They have programs specifically designed for delicate clothing like woollens. They also utilize moisture sensors to determine the best drying time for

each load. Some also have a built-in eco mode, which reduces temperature and uses less energy.
The door's large opening on a tumble dryer with a heat pump allows you to load and unload even larger clothes. You can also keep an eye on the drying process of your laundry with the internal light, which comes on after the cycle has ended. This can help you spot any small or unnoticed items that require a little extra care or minimize wrinkles for easier ironing.
All heat pump tumble dryers need regular maintenance, including clearing out the lint filter to avoid fire hazards. Some models have a built-in filter that collects the fluff and other particles in a controlled manner, but the majority require you to manually remove the lint from the filter at least once per month. This is crucial because not cleaning the filter on a regular basis could result in a buildup which causes the machine to use more energy.
Energy efficiency
A tumble dryer with a heat pump is the most efficient tumble dryer available. It uses hot air to help in the absorption of water from the laundry, and collects this in a tank which is then re-heated. The heated air is circulated through the drum to aid in helping your clothes dry faster.
These dryers use less energy than a tumble-dryer with condenser technology which means you'll save on average PS330 per annum in household energy bills. They're ideal if you have a large family and require drying loads of clothing quickly.
They operate at a lower drying temperature than condenser tumble dryers therefore your clothes remain beautiful for longer, and there's less chance of shrinkage that is annoying. They are also healthier for the earth as they do not produce harmful gases and they are quieter than other dryers.
In addition the heat pump dryer doesn't require an external hose connection since it utilizes the heat inside the house to dry the laundry. This makes it more flexible, as it can be used in any part of the home.
A heat pump dryer that has a A+energy label could save you up to EUR 1545 in the long run when compared to the conventional B-rated condenser (based on 160 cycles). These savings are made possible due to the fact that they use less power and operate at lower temperatures.
When choosing an A++and tumble dryer heat pump you'll need to ensure it's compatible with your home. Installation instructions can be found on the site of the manufacturer. If you want to ensure that your appliance is installed safely and correctly, consider hiring an expert. It's also worth checking the lint filters regularly in case you don't do it, as failing to do so could result in a fire hazard.
When you wash your laundry, you need to follow the instructions for care on the labels of your fabric. The temperature, spin speed, and duration of operation should be observed to the letter. Overloading your machine can cause a lot of damage to your clothes and can cause a malfunction. So, be sure to only dry loads that can comfortably fit in your dryer.
Noise
Heat pump tumble dryers are more energy efficient than standard appliances because they circulate warm air, which means that you'll use less energy to heat your clothes. The heat pump tumble dryers are also quieter since they don't make use of vents to dry your clothes. Instead, they make use of the air that is in your home.
A tumble dryer heat pump is often more expensive than other appliances. However, the cost will pay off in the long run by reducing your electric bills and environmental footprint. Some models have a digital display that shows the amount of energy you use so you can track the savings. This is ideal for people who want to track their energy consumption and alter their habits of consumption.
Many of our tumble dryers have special programs that are designed to gently dry your clothing while taking care of them. This is due to the unique heat pump technology that recirculates warm air within the machine and protects delicate clothes from extreme temperatures. It's also due to this that these machines have an energy efficiency rating that is higher than traditional vented tumble dryers with the majority achieving an A+ rating.
